Deer Season!
Just got back form a nice 100 mile ride through Amsih country, mid Ohio. I'm always cautious watching for buggys, tourists, and the occasional "animal". Today at high noon, after cresting a hill and heading into a downward left hander, I spotted a deer running full tilt along a tree line heading across the road 100 yards ahead of me. I down shifted and got on the brake just as the second popped put of the woods directly in front of me. I still had enough time to avoid any dangerous situation, but darn if those things don't always pop up when I'm not in my tree stand:) Always remeber when you see one, others are certain to be nearby.
